Summary
While reviewing whether Phase 4's exit condition is met, found a discrepancy:
10-delivery-plan.md's Phase 4 bullet list included "local history" as in-scope, but06-ui-requirements.mdalways filed query history under "useful soon after (not blocking V1)" — never "Required" — and the Phase 4 design spec (docs/superpowers/specs/2026-07-19-phase-4-web-interface-design.md) made that deferral explicit before implementation started, citing that exact source. The delivery-plan bullet just never caught up to that decision.Corrects the summary to match the spec's deferral (not the other way around) and adds a one-line pointer so a future reader doesn't have to reconstruct the same reference chain across three docs again.
Test plan
Docs-only change, no code affected.
